Dreamliner flight cancelled after brake problem in Japan: airport

09 Jan, 2013

 

ANA 698 was cancelled because brake parts from the rear left undercarriage needed to be replaced, said the spokesman at Yamaguchi Ube airport in western Japan.

 

On Tuesday a Japan Airlines Boeing 787 was grounded in Boston following a fuel spill, one day after another plane of the same type suffered a fire.
